如何使用sql(use sql)

SQL代表结构化查询语言,最初由IBM在70年代开发,用于与关系数据库交互。它是数据库的通用语言,具有相当的可读性,并且学习基础知识相对简单(尽管该语言可能非常强大)。...

台阶

  1. 1“SQL”通常发音为“S-Q-L”(结构化查询语言)。SQL最初是由Donald D.Chamberlin和Raymond F.Boyce在20世纪70年代初在IBM开发的。这个版本被称为SEQUEL(结构化英语查询语言)。
  2. Image titled Use SQL Step 1
  3. 2 SQL有各种方言,但目前使用最广泛的数据库引擎遵循ANSI的SQL99标准,许多供应商已经实现了扩展该标准的额外功能(Microsoft的“风格”SQL称为T-SQL或Transact-SQL,Oracle版本为PL/SQL)。
  4. Image titled Use SQL Step 2
  5. 3获取数据!这就是它通常的意义所在。为此,我们使用SELECT语句;它将从SQL数据库中查询或检索数据。
  6. Image titled Use SQL Step 3
  7. 4A一个简单的例子是这样的:“从tblMyCDList中选择*”,它将获得表“TBLMYCTLIST”中的所有列(这就是*所在的位置)和行。
  8. Image titled Use SQL Step 4
  9. 5查询通常比这复杂得多。select可以用于从表中挑出特定的列和行,甚至可以将多个表中的数据或数据库链接在一起。
  10. Image titled Use SQL Step 5
  11. 6如果我们想过滤select语句返回的行,需要一个where子句来限定返回的记录集。”从tblMyCDList中选择*其中CDid=27'将检索字段CDid等于27的行。或者从tblAttribute中选择*,其中strCDName(如“黑暗面%”)使用通配符表示任何角色的零个或多个实例,并希望显示我的收藏中确实有我最喜欢的Pink Floyd专辑。
  12. Image titled Use SQL Step 6
  13. 7INSERT和UPDATE语句用于添加和更改SQL数据库中的数据(请查看下面的链接,以获取一些可以帮助您进一步了解的优秀教程)。
  14. Image titled Use SQL Step 7
  15. 8 DELETE语句用于从SQL数据库中删除数据。
  16. Image titled Use SQL Step 8
  • 从Microsoft Access中连接到SQL数据库非常容易(它的查询工具可以在SQL模式下使用,尽管语法与SQL Server和其他数据库的语法不同)。
  • 在Linux下,最流行的数据库可能是MySQL和PostgreSQL。如果控制台似乎不方便,请使用ExecuteQuery或其他类似的开源工具。
  • Microsoft Query是Windows附带的工具,它具有图形或SQL查询模式。

你可能感兴趣的文章

使用sql连接字符串的巧妙方法

... 如何连接 ...

  • 发布于 2021-03-13 07:05
  • 阅读 ( 233 )

所有程序员都应该知道的13条最重要的sql命令

... 注意行的顺序是如何变化的吗?Union以最有效的方式运行,因此返回的数据可以按顺序变化。 ...

  • 发布于 2021-03-14 06:57
  • 阅读 ( 225 )

如何将sql数据库备份到网络共享

必须定期备份SQL数据库。我们已经介绍了可以轻松地将所有SQL server数据库备份到本地硬盘驱动器的方法,但这并不能防止驱动器和/或系统故障。作为针对此类灾难的额外保护层,您可以在网络共享上复制或直接创建备份。 本...

  • 发布于 2021-04-13 10:39
  • 阅读 ( 210 )

为您的网络设置lan唤醒控制面板

...面板配置为使用用户实例的sqlexpress,但我们将向您展示如何使用sqlserver的完整版本。 桌面计算机必须配置远程唤醒功能。通常,这是网卡的默认设置,但如果您想确定,可以在设备管理器中检查网卡的设备属性。 总的来说,可...

  • 发布于 2021-04-13 12:18
  • 阅读 ( 180 )

sql语句(sql)和mysql数据库(mysql)的区别

...或删除存储在特定数据库中的数据的函数。SQL不需要指定如何获取数据库中的记录。这使它成为一种自然的数据库语言。它于1986年发布,被誉为使用最广泛的数据库语言。作为第四代编程语言,SQL在本质上也是多范式的。SQL代...

  • 发布于 2021-07-07 07:01
  • 阅读 ( 252 )

sql语句(sql)和hql公司(hql)的区别

...告诉数据库需要做什么,并让RDBMS决定实现的细节(需要如何做)它的优点是不需要用户编写大量的代码,但由于隐藏的业务规则,用户只能部分控制数据库,而且界面相当复杂。什么是hql公司(hql)?HQL或Hibernate查询语言是一种...

  • 发布于 2021-07-10 03:06
  • 阅读 ( 352 )

nosql公司(nosql)和sql数据库(sql database)的区别

...及对其中的数据执行各种操作。然而,nosql数据库通常不使用表格式关系进行存储(the two is the fact that sql databases utilize sql, i.e. structured query language as the standardized programming language for managing relational databases as well as for performing various ...

  • 发布于 2021-07-12 19:39
  • 阅读 ( 275 )

如何使用sql server 2012导入和导出数据(import and export data with sql server 2012)

SQL Server导入和导出向导允许您轻松地从以下任何数据源将信息导入SQL Server 2012数据库: 微软Excel 数据库 平面文件 另一个SQL Server数据库 该向导通过用户友好的图形界面构建SQL Server集成服务(SSIS)包。 启动sql server导...

  • 发布于 2021-09-06 15:27
  • 阅读 ( 183 )

2021年9本最佳sql书籍

...,篇幅相对较短,旨在帮助读者掌握基本知识并快速学习如何执行有用的任务。书中充满了实际操作的例子和有用的解释,以一种简单易懂的风格写成,不需要太多或任何先验知识。这本书不需要访问现有的数据库服务器,这对...

  • 发布于 2021-09-08 10:55
  • 阅读 ( 255 )

showtables-sql命令

...SQL是一种开源关系数据库管理软件,网站所有者和其他人使用它来组织和检索数据库中的数据。一个数据库由一个或多个具有多个列的表组成,每个列包含信息。在关系数据库中,表可以相互交叉引用。如果运行网站并使用MySQL...

  • 发布于 2021-09-26 02:27
  • 阅读 ( 196 )